I did it!!!!!!

I just filled out the applications for 2 different organizations for adopting a dog. I have wanted a companion for Hailey, so obviously she has to approve of the dog. It can't be a small dog, for some reason she really doesn't care for toy or mini dogs. She will tolerate them for a short time, but then will walk away when they start jumping on her. I think she realizes she could hurt one with one swipe of her paw. She is used to the Shih Tzu across the street. This morning she was playing with Dempsey's dad, jumping and wagging her tail, and with every wag, she got Dempsey in the head. He didn't mind a bit, too bad we didn't have the video, it was hysterical to watch.

Wish me luck!!!!!!
